Форум программистов, компьютерный форум CyberForum.ru

Программирование Android

Войти
Регистрация
Восстановить пароль
 
yura91
30 / 28 / 2
Регистрация: 23.10.2013
Сообщений: 2,249
#1

Для чего используется класс Looper? - Программирование Android

21.07.2016, 21:11. Просмотров 146. Ответов 0
Метки нет (Все метки)

Для чего используется класс Looper? Вот Handler может отправлять сообщения в очередь из другого потока в поток, в котором этот handler был создан. А Looper как управляет этой очередью? Он может менять порядок сообщений в ней? То есть Handler ставит сообщение в очередь в одном потоке и в другом может его забрать на обработку логика такая получается, так для чего нужен Looper?

Добавлено через 1 час 46 минут
Если у потока не определен looper например обычный Thread() то в нем нельзя по очереди обрабатывать сообщения?
Similar
Эксперт
41792 / 34177 / 6122
Регистрация: 12.04.2006
Сообщений: 57,940
21.07.2016, 21:11
Здравствуйте! Я подобрал для вас темы с ответами на вопрос Для чего используется класс Looper? (Программирование Android):

Для чего применяется класс OAuthConsumer при публикации приложений в твиттере? - Программирование Android
для чего применяется этот класс в публикации приложений в твиттере ?? Он помоему сохраняет пользовательский логин и пароль ?? а как туда...

Can't create handler inside thread that has not called Looper.prepare() - Программирование Android
Привет, с Новым Годом! Подскажите почему приложение вылетает с ошибкой при показе progressdialog. Ошибка: ...

Как вытащить данные из потока. Cant create handler inside thread that has not called Looper.prepare() - Программирование Android
В общем столкнулся со следующей неприятной проблемой. Есть клиент. Он запрашивает у сервера некоторые данные. Сервер эти данные посылает...

Что за view используется для меню в OneDrive - Программирование Android
Видели приложение OneDrive от мелкософта для Андроид? Вот там снизу менюшка. Что это за элемент управления? Спасибо.

Для чего нужно UUID - Программирование Android
Ребят изучаю андройд совсем недавно, можете кто-нибудь понятно объяснить для чего используется UUID?

Для чего нужен contentDescription - Программирование Android
Всем привет! Я прочитал официальную документацию, но всё равно я не пойму для чего нужен contentDescription. А главное нужно его...

Надоела реклама? Зарегистрируйтесь и она исчезнет полностью.
MoreAnswers
Эксперт
37091 / 29110 / 5898
Регистрация: 17.06.2006
Сообщений: 43,301
21.07.2016, 21:11
Привет! Вот еще темы с ответами:

Для чего нужен Gradle - Программирование Android
Новая студия почти навязчиво предлагает перевести мои проекты в Gradle - в окне при запуске проекта выпрыгивает "ваш проект не Gradle. Как...

Для чего нужен Super.onStartCommand - Программирование Android
Здравствуйте. А для чего надо писать так? public int onStartCommand (Intent intent, int flags, int startId) { ...

Для чего нужны миниатюры изображения? - Программирование Android
Я знаю что для любого изображения есть размер его миниатюры(thumbnails изображение) как вы думаете для чего может понадобиться уменьшение...

Для чего нужен android.support.v4 - Программирование Android
Вопрос к знатокам: почему AS по умолчанию импортирует в проект классы из библиотеки поддержки? minSdk 19 (4.4). Еще просвятите плз -...


Искать еще темы с ответами

Или воспользуйтесь поиском по форуму:
Ответ Создать тему
Опции темы

К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2017, vBulletin Solutions, Inc.
Рейтинг@Mail.ru